This is how I landed upon the Chilipad Sleep System. The Chilipad Sleep System is a mattress pad that connects, by means of a long, flat tube, to a temperature-regulating cube. To use it, you pour water into the cube (more information on that in a moment) and set a temperature from a dial on the cube or a push-button control that comes with it.

The cube is where the magic occurs, heating & cooling water (depending on what the user wants when they sleep), before pumping the temperature-controlled water through the tube into the pad, which is filled with smaller silicone tubes. ( The stain was currently on my desk chair, if you were questioning.) The last step: filling the cube with the water. This part is slightly laborious, because first you pour in 12 ounces of water, then plug in the cube to a power outlet, wait a bit, then gather little amounts until the raindrop that flashes on a screen atop the cube stops flashing.

Rather, I used water from a Brita filter, which, up until now, has yet to make the cube combust. (Chilipad most likely suggests pure water due to the potential mineral deposits in faucet water that could ultimately clog up the maker. I figure the majority of people do not have a stash of distilled water, and the business probably figures that, too, considering it likewise sells a cleaning solution for the cube.) It draws the warmth out of the bed and blows it into the rest of the space. To go to sleep, your body must lower its core temperature level. As soon as you are asleep, the quality of that sleep is determined in large part by how successful you were in lowering your core body temperature.

Frequently one partner desires the space and the bed warmer than the other: more frequently the female wants it warmer than the man.

What Is A Chilipad

In truth, it isn't simply that you can cool one side more than the other (chilipad reviews). You can cool one side to as low as 55F (12. 8C) and really warm the other to as high as 110F (43. 3C).
